WebJul 30, 2024 · In general, the adsorptivity of compounds increases with increased polarity (i.e. the more polar the compound then the stronger it binds to the adsorbent). Non-polar compounds move up the plate most rapidly (higher Rf value), whereas polar substances travel up the TLC plate slowly or not at all (lower Rf value). http://www.chem.ualberta.ca/~orglabtutorials/Techniques%20Extra%20Info/TLC.html
